About Hayseed and Housdon

HAND PICKED. HAND SORTED. HAND MADE. At Hayseed and Housdon we produce high quality craft wines that we believe represent good value to Paso Robles wine enthusiasts – no matter their place on the spectrum. Our approach is simple: we source top grade grapes from sustainably farmed vineyards in the Paso Robles and Edna Valley appellations, apply proven wine making techniques and then wait for the fruit to do its thing in generally new French oak or steel barrels that are truly stainless.

We do not use concentrates or other additives intended to enhance (i.e. fix) the flavor, texture or aroma of our wine. When we sell our wine – often quite late at our Railroad Street tasting garage location – we split half the profit with one of several local non-profit organizations including Paso Cares, Wine4Paws, RISE and Operation Surf and CASA of SLO County.

You can buy a bottle so support one of their local non-profit partners:

  •  4:19 to Paso – Rosé: Paso Cares – an organization that provides for the immediate and longer-term needs of homeless residents of Paso Robles and SLO County.
  • Pray for Love – Edna Valley Pinot Noir: Wine4Paws & Woods Humane Society – an organization that provides pet adoption services and the humane care of dogs & cats in SLO County.
  • Excuse My Dust & Steel Reins – Chardonnay: Lumina Alliance – Lumina Alliance provides crisis intervention, counseling and other services to survivors of sexual and intimate partner violence.
  • Warrior – Cabernet & Petite Sirah Blend – Operation surf – SLO County based organization that helps wounded and injured active duty military and veteran heroes move forward in a positive direction through an epic, life-changing surfing experience.
  • Rhône Rodeo – GSM – CASA – an organization that advocates for the best interests of abused and neglected children within the court system.
  • La Macha – The 805 Undocu Fund – a non-profit organization that provides financial assistance to working families within our community that due to their immigration status are not eligible for government programs.

Hayseed and Houdson is also proud to announce they now offer Metronome Brut Cuvee by Holli Epperly. This Brut Cuvee was made in the traditional champagne method. The base blend, consisting of Viognier and Grenache, was fermented in stainless steel barrels to retain the vibrancy of the fruit. This delicious sparkling wine is limited and perfect for a hot day in Paso Robles ☀️
